Android Developer
Job details
We are seeking a talented and motivated Android Developer to join our dynamic team. As an Android Developer, you will be responsible for developing, enhancing, and maintaining mobile applications that meet our company's and clients' needs. You will work closely with cross-functional teams to design, build, and deploy high-quality apps. Responsibilities:
- Design and build advanced applications for the Android platform
- Collaborate with cross-functional teams to define, design, and ship new features
- Troubleshoot, debug, and resolve production issues
- Ensure the best possible performance, quality, and responsiveness of applications
- Continuously discover, evaluate, and implement new technologies to maximize development efficiency
- Maintain code quality, organization, and automation
- Stay updated with the latest Android development trends and technologies
- Bachelor's degree in Computer Science, Engineering, or a related field
- 1-3 years of professional Android development experience
- Strong knowledge of Android SDK, different versions of Android, and how to deal with different screen sizes
- Proficient in Java/Kotlin, with a solid understanding of object-oriented programming principles
- Experience with RESTful APIs to connect Android applications to back-end services
- Familiarity with cloud message APIs and push notifications
- Knowledge of UI/UX standards and guidelines for Android
- Experience with version control tools like Git
- Understanding of mobile app development lifecycle and Agile methodologies
Apply safely
To stay safe in your job search, information on common scams and to get free expert advice, we recommend that you visit SAFERjobs, a non-profit, joint industry and law enforcement organization working to combat job scams.